The report describes the channel improvement which consists of a two-lane, two-level channel into York River; the inbound lane 50 feet deep by 500 feet wide and the outbound lane 37 feet deep by 250 feet wide between the 50-foot contour in Chesapeake Bay to the vicinity of the American Oil Company's marine terminal. Environmental impacts are discussed.
